Question 237517: In rhombus ABCD, the measure, in inches, of AB is 3x + 2 and BC is x + 12. Find the number of inches in the length of DC.

A rhombus has equal measure all around.
This means we can equate the given expressions and solve for x as step one.
3x + 2 = x + 12
3x - x = -2 + 12
2x = 10
x = 10/2
x = 5
Now, side AB = side DC.
AB was given to be 3x + 2.
Let x = 5
AB = 3(5) + 2
AB = 15 + 2
AB = 17 inches
If AB = DC, then DC = 17 inches
